      Charles "Chuck" J. Stiennen Sr.


      Charles “Chuck” J. Stiennen, Sr. of Howell, Passed away on Tuesday, June 23, 2009 at Care One at Wall. Mr. Stiennen was born in Newark, NJ and had lived in Howell for the past 41 years.

      He was a truck driver for Nappi Trucking in Matawan for thirty years, before retiring in 1993. After retiring, Mr. Stiennen was a driver for Easter Seals in Neptune for five years. He was a parishioner of St. Veronica’s Catholic Church in Howell. Mr. Stiennen was a U.S. Army Veteran, serving during the Korean War and World War II.

      He was predeceased by a son, William Stiennen in 1999. He is survived by his Wife of 48 years, Frances M. Stiennen of Howell, a son Charles Stiennen, Jr of Chandler, AZ. Two daughters, Patricia Stallworth of Jackson and Catherine Skripak of Howell. One Daughter-in-Law Susan Stiennen of Lawrence, MA, nine grandchildren, two great grand children and one sister, Joan Keitel of Iselin, NJ.
